Are there protection and security programs for Politically Exposed Persons in Costa Rica?
Yes, there are protection and security programs for Politically Exposed Persons in Costa Rica. These programs seek to guarantee the physical and personal security of PEPs who may face threats or risks due to their political position. Protective measures may be provided, such as escorts, security cameras, armored vehicles, and specific security protocols. These measures are implemented by specialized security institutions and are adjusted to the specific needs and risks of each PEP.

What is the typology of "smurfing" and how is it prevented in Mexico?
Mexico The "smurfing" typology is a common technique used in money laundering, which consists of dividing large amounts of money into smaller amounts and depositing them in multiple bank accounts to avoid attracting attention. In Mexico, smurfing is prevented through the implementation of mechanisms for monitoring and detecting unusual and suspicious transactions by financial institutions and the FIU. In addition, cooperation between institutions and the exchange of information is promoted to identify suspicious patterns and behaviors related to smurfing.
What type of corrective actions can financial institutions take to remedy KYC non-compliance?
They can implement internal changes, reinforce policies and procedures, allocate additional resources for regulatory compliance, and collaborate with authorities to remedy identified deficiencies.
